2: Organize Under-Sink Area with Baskets

The under-sink area is often a neglected storage zone in most bathrooms, transforming quickly into a chaotic jumble of cleaning supplies, extra toiletries, and miscellaneous items. Strategic basket organization can turn this challenging space into a model of efficiency and tidiness. Baskets serve as an excellent solution for managing the typically awkward and cramped under-sink environment. By selecting the right containers, you can create compartments that maximize every inch of available space. Stackable, waterproof baskets work particularly well in bathroom settings where moisture is a constant concern.

When selecting and arranging under-sink baskets, consider these key strategies:

  • Color Code: Use different colored baskets for specific categories like personal care, cleaning supplies, and first aid items

  • Size Variety: Mix small and medium baskets to accommodate different item sizes and shapes

8: Install a Tension Rod for Cleaning Supplies

Tension rods represent an ingenious and adaptable storage solution for organizing cleaning supplies in bathrooms, transforming awkward under-sink spaces into efficient storage zones. These versatile tools provide a robust hanging mechanism without requiring permanent wall modifications, making them perfect for renters and homeowners alike. Adjustable tension rods create vertical hanging spaces ideal for spray bottles, cleaning brushes, and lightweight maintenance tools. By suspending items vertically, you reclaim valuable floor and shelf space, creating a more organized and accessible storage environment. Stainless steel or corrosion resistant rods work exceptionally well in moisture prone bathroom environments.
